Looking for Child Custody Lawyers in Tyrone?

Child custody lawyers focus on resolving disputes between parents regarding the care and upbringing of their children, typically during a divorce or separation. They help establish or modify parenting plans, visitation schedules, and decision-making authority. Their primary goal is to advocate for their client's parental rights while upholding the child's best interests.
